Keyless Entry

The keyless entry feature is popular since it lets you unlock your car without a traditional key. It operates by transmitting an electronic signal to the car via an electronic receiver that is located near the door. This technology is commonly used in automobiles and provides convenience for both you and your passengers. You don't need to worry about losing your keys, which is why it makes it easier to secure your car.

Remote Start

Remote start is exactly what it is. It sounds exactly like. You can start your car without having to be inside the vehicle or turn the ignition key. audi replacement car keys It is accomplished by transmitting signals from your key fob to the control device that is connected to the ignition switch and the starter mechanism. The system will then start your engine and run it for a designated amount of time, usually up to 10 or 15 minutes. The system will shut down automatically, or be manually activated by pressing the button for locking on your OEM key fob.
